Add the water, soy sauce, orange juice, vinegar, brown sugar, ketchup, garlic, pepper flakes, and ground black pepper to a bowl or measuring cup. Mix until well combined and set it aside.
Add the oil to a pan over medium high heat. Place the chicken and add the salt and pepper. Stir and fry until no longer pink and cooked through.
Pour the sauce in and bring it to a boil.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er for about 15 minutes.
Mix the corn starch and water. Add it to the chicken mixture and stir until it thickens.
Serve over hot steaming rice and garnish with some green onions and sesame seeds.
